The Role of Essential Oils

The shelves aren't exactly overflowing with aromatherapy-based skin care products, but these items are quickly becoming more widely available online and at select specialty boutiques. The benefits of aromatherapy are simply too great to ignore, and manufacturers are taking advantage of this fact by infusing their products with essential oils.

These therapeutic oils not only smell great, they're also essential elements of a skin care regimen designed to treat specific ailments. Even if you don't necessarily suffer from any particular issue, you can still enjoy the aromatic, soothing properties of these oils. When they are properly diluted and prepared for use on the skin, oil-based products (such as lotions, mineral baths, massage oils and body washes) are readily dissolved into and absorbed by the skin's protective sebum.

Aromatherapy for Different Skin Types

What's your skin type? Just like every skin type is different, so too are essential oils. Each offers a different benefit, and some are more appropriate for some skin types than others.

Normal

If you're blessed with that seemingly elusive "normal" skin type, you're in luck. Almost any skin-safe essential oil will work for you. Lavender is the most versatile and universal of oils, and its properties are beneficial to all skin types.

Dry and Sensitive

Keep dry skin lubricated and nourished with an impressive combination of essential oils. German and Roman chamomile, geranium, patchouli, lavender, rose absolute, neroli, jasmine, sandalwood and carrot seed are all recommended. If your skin is sensitive, avoid using high percentage oils as they may cause adverse reactions. Avoid spicy scents, such as cinnamon, at all costs.

Oily and Combination

Oily and combination skin types require aromatherapy products that reduce the production of excess sebum and create a harmonious balance. Antiseptic essential oils are especially effective. Recommended oils include pink grapefruit, geranium, lavender, juniper berry, ylang ylang, myrtle, cypress and peppermint.

Mature and Aging

Though aging skin can't be avoided completely, the right essential oils can help slow down the process, hydrate the skin and restore skin tone. Frankincense, carrot seed, patchouli, myrrh, rose absolute and sandalwood are highly recommended.
